About the Job
General Summary of Position
Performs decontamination sterilization and processing of supplies and equipment used during invasive and non-invasive procedures. May be assigned to different areas of Sterile Processing focusing on a variety of duties which all require the use of state-of-the-art sterile processing methods and strict adherence to established departmental policies and procedures.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ities
- Cleans carts surgical instruments power and specialty equipment and utensils using washer-sterilizers sonic washers and dryers per established procedures. Checks equipment to determine proper functioning.
- Sorts assembles and wraps instruments specialty equipment and utensils for sterilization distribution or storage according to department standards.
- Checks procedure trays and instrument sets for accuracy consistency and condition of instruments following established protocols. Initials all work performed.
- Assembles and packages linen used for exchange and case carts test packs and departments. Assists in assembling operating room (OR) case carts e.g. emergency eye etc.
- Sterilizes cleaned assembled and wrapped sets and supplies using gas and steam sterilizers and gas aerators.
- Monitors sterilizers aerators washer-sterilizers and other equipment for proper functioning and reports malfunctions to appropriate supervisor.
- Inventories/stocks OR section carts exchange carts and storage cabinets utilizing hand held computers. Removes damaged and/or outdated items following established policies and procedures.
- Completes daily productivity reports and initials all work performed as required.
- Attends seminars and in-services to maintain certification and up-to-date knowledge of sterile processing methods and practices.
- May serve as charge and resource person during the absence of the Lead SPD Technician and/or assists with training of SPD personnel as needed.
